Delta 9 THC Metabolism — Why Dosing Varies by Individual
Delta 9 THC undergoes first-pass metabolism in the liver when consumed orally, where the cytochrome P450 enzyme system (specifically CYP2C9 and CYP3A4) converts Delta 9 THC into 11-hydroxy-THC. A metabolite 2–3 times more potent than the parent compound and significantly more psychoactive. This metabolic conversion is genetically variable: individuals with high CYP2C9 activity metabolize Delta 9 rapidly, experiencing shorter but more intense effects, while those with low enzyme activity process it slowly, extending duration but reducing peak intensity. Genetic testing for CYP2C9 variants is commercially available but rarely used outside clinical contexts. Most users discover their metabolic profile through trial observation.
Body composition affects cannabinoid distribution because Delta 9 THC is lipophilic. It dissolves in fat, not water. Higher body fat percentage increases the volume of distribution, meaning a given dose disperses across a larger lipid reservoir, reducing peak plasma concentration. Two people of identical weight but different body composition (one 18% body fat, one 32% body fat) will experience meaningfully different peak effects from the same 10mg dose. This is not tolerance. It is pharmacokinetics.
Food intake at the time of consumption significantly alters absorption. Taking Delta 9 on an empty stomach produces faster onset (45–60 minutes) but higher peak plasma levels, increasing the probability of discomfort if the dose is too high. Taking Delta 9 with a high-fat meal delays onset to 90–120 minutes but increases total bioavailability by 3–5 times. Fat in the digestive tract enhances cannabinoid absorption through the lymphatic system, bypassing some of the first-pass liver metabolism. Safe Dosing Ranges — Beginner to Experienced User Profiles
Clinical guidance from cannabis research institutions including Johns Hopkins and the University of Colorado defines threshold dosing (the minimum dose producing perceptible effects) at 2.5mg Delta 9 THC for cannabis-naive individuals. At this level, effects include mild euphoria, slight time distortion, and subtle sensory enhancement. Sufficient for most therapeutic applications including anxiety reduction and sleep onset support. Doses below 2.5mg are considered sub-perceptual for most adults and function as microdoses, producing potential anti-inflammatory and neuroprotective effects without subjective intoxication.
Moderate dosing (5–15mg) represents the therapeutic range for most regular cannabis users. This range produces noticeable relaxation, mood elevation, and perceptual changes without overwhelming cognitive function. Users report enhanced music appreciation, appetite stimulation, and reduced physical tension. This is the target range for most commercial edible products marketed for recreational use. High dosing (20–50mg) is appropriate only for experienced users with documented tolerance. At this level, effects include significant cognitive impairment, pronounced euphoria, potential visual distortions, and extended duration (6–10 hours). Doses above 30mg increase the probability of adverse reactions including tachycardia (heart rate exceeding 100 bpm), acute anxiety, and paranoia. Particularly in users without established tolerance. The recreational cannabis industry in legal markets shows average product dosing of 10mg per serving, with medical formulations ranging from 2.5mg for symptom management to 25mg for chronic pain or insomnia.
Extreme dosing (above 50mg) is rarely advisable outside specialized medical contexts. Emergency department data from states with legal cannabis markets show that accidental overconsumption of edibles accounts for a significant portion of cannabis-related ED visits, with doses typically exceeding 100mg in patients reporting distressing symptoms. These symptoms resolve without intervention within 12–24 hours, but the subjective experience is sufficiently unpleasant that users consistently report it as aversive. There is no evidence that high-dose Delta 9 produces lasting physiological harm. But the acute distress is real and preventable through appropriate dosing.

What If: Delta 9 THC Dosage Scenarios
What If I Accidentally Take Too Much Delta 9 THC?
Reduce stimulation immediately. Move to a quiet, familiar environment and avoid additional sensory input. Acute Delta 9 overconsumption produces tachycardia, anxiety, and time distortion, but symptoms resolve without intervention within 6–12 hours. Hydration and rest are the only required interventions. There is no antidote, and attempting to 'sleep it off' is often counterproductive because Delta 9 disrupts sleep architecture at high doses. If symptoms include chest pain, sustained heart rate above 120 bpm, or difficulty breathing, seek medical evaluation. These are rare but indicate potential cardiovascular stress requiring observation.
What If I Feel Nothing After 60 Minutes?
Wait an additional 60 minutes before re-dosing. Edible Delta 9 onset varies from 45–120 minutes based on gastric contents, metabolic rate, and product formulation. The most common dosing error in first-time users is taking a second dose at the 60-minute mark, resulting in cumulative effects exceeding intended levels when both doses peak simultaneously. If you feel nothing after 120 minutes, your dose was likely sub-threshold. Increase by 2.5mg on your next attempt, not during the current session.
What If My Tolerance Increases Over Time?
CB1 receptor downregulation occurs with chronic Delta 9 exposure, reducing sensitivity and requiring higher doses to achieve equivalent effects. A 48–72 hour abstinence period partially restores receptor density, while a 2–4 week tolerance break resets sensitivity to near-baseline levels. Tolerance develops faster with daily use than with intermittent use. Users consuming Delta 9 more than 4 days per week typically report needing 50–100% higher doses within 6–8 weeks compared to their initial effective dose. Cycling use (5 days on, 2 days off, or 2 weeks on, 1 week off) significantly slows tolerance development.
What If I Want to Combine Delta 9 With CBD?
CBD modulates Delta 9 psychoactivity through negative allosteric modulation at CB1 receptors, reducing Delta 9 binding affinity and dampening peak effects without eliminating them. A CBD-to-Delta 9 ratio of 10:1 or higher (e.g., 25mg CBD with 2.5mg Delta 9) produces anxiolytic and analgesic effects with minimal psychoactivity. Ratios below 5:1 do not meaningfully reduce Delta 9 intensity. Recognizing and Managing Delta 9 Overconsumption
Acute Delta 9 overconsumption produces a predictable symptom cluster: tachycardia (resting heart rate exceeding 100 bpm), shortness of breath unrelated to airway obstruction, acute anxiety or panic, temporal disorientation (difficulty tracking time passage), and in severe cases, visual or auditory distortions. These symptoms peak 90–180 minutes after ingestion and resolve gradually over 6–12 hours. The experience is subjectively distressing but physiologically benign in otherwise healthy individuals. Delta 9 does not suppress respiratory drive, does not cause seizures, and has no documented cases of fatal overdose in humans despite widespread use.
Immediate management involves environmental modification: reduce sensory stimulation by moving to a quiet, dimly lit space; avoid additional substances including alcohol or caffeine; maintain hydration with water or electrolyte solutions; and if possible, have a trusted person present to provide reassurance. Attempting physical activity or engaging in cognitively demanding tasks typically worsens anxiety symptoms because Delta 9 impairs motor coordination and executive function at high doses. The most effective intervention is passive rest in a safe environment until peak effects subside.
Black pepper contains beta-caryophyllene, a terpene that acts as a CB2 receptor agonist and may modulate Delta 9 effects through receptor competition. Anecdotal reports suggest chewing 3–4 black peppercorns or inhaling crushed black pepper aroma reduces acute anxiety symptoms, though controlled clinical evidence is limited. CBD, if available, can be taken at doses of 25–50mg to dampen CB1 activation through negative allosteric modulation. This will not eliminate intoxication but may reduce peak intensity by 20–30% within 30–60 minutes. Neither intervention reverses Delta 9 effects. They modulate them.
Emergency department evaluation is warranted if symptoms include sustained chest pain, heart rate exceeding 120 bpm for more than 30 minutes, loss of consciousness, or severe agitation that poses a safety risk. ED treatment is supportive. Intravenous fluids, benzodiazepines for severe anxiety, and cardiac monitoring if indicated. There is no pharmacological antidote to Delta 9 THC. Most patients are observed for 4–6 hours and discharged once symptoms resolve. The key distinction: Delta 9 overconsumption is not medically dangerous in healthy individuals, but it can mimic symptoms of more serious conditions (panic attacks can feel like cardiac events), making professional evaluation appropriate when uncertainty exists.

Delta 9 dosing is not intuitive because the feedback loop between consumption and effect is delayed by 45–120 minutes. This delay creates a mismatch between action and consequence that does not exist with inhaled cannabis, where effects appear within minutes and allow real-time titration. Respect the delay by treating every dose as a commitment to a 6–8 hour effect window, and dose accordingly. If you are uncertain whether your dose is sufficient, waiting is always safer than adding more. You can take an additional dose tomorrow, but you cannot untake the dose you consumed today. Start at 2.5mg, observe the full effect profile over 4–6 hours, and adjust by 2.5mg increments on your next session. This approach is slow, methodical, and boring. But it prevents the single most common Delta 9 dosing mistake, which is impatience.

Why do edibles feel stronger than smoked cannabis? ▼
Orally consumed Delta 9 THC undergoes first-pass liver metabolism, where enzymes convert it to 11-hydroxy-THC — a metabolite 2–3 times more potent and significantly more psychoactive than the parent compound. Inhaled cannabis bypasses liver metabolism initially, producing less 11-hydroxy-THC and milder effects per milligram. This metabolic difference, combined with the delayed onset of edibles (45–90 minutes versus 2–10 minutes for inhalation), makes dose titration harder and overconsumption more common with oral products. The slower feedback loop between consumption and effect increases the probability of taking a second dose before the first has fully metabolized.
